Substance3D - Painter versions 9.1.1 and earlier are affected by a Write-what-where Condition vulnerability that could result in arbitrary code execution in the context of the current user. Exploitation of this issue requires user interaction in that a victim must open a malicious file.

CVE-2024-20741 has a high severity rating due to its potential for arbitrary code execution.
To fix CVE-2024-20741, users should update Adobe Substance 3D Painter to version 9.1.2 or later.
CVE-2024-20741 affects all versions of Adobe Substance 3D Painter up to and including version 9.1.1.
CVE-2024-20741 is a Write-what-where Condition vulnerability that could lead to arbitrary code execution.
Exploitation of CVE-2024-20741 requires user interaction, specifically the opening of a malicious file.
